Output 58c38d0a54fb82070bd0c5ccbfc30b68dd0aef4b1bfe2b222a30b6c813f5f7e2:1

value
1800000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6680cc7f3c149540067836c964602c795bc058a8 OP_EQUAL
address
3B319D5hqmJxBsuxq5P2DC9auZcZa666Fw
transaction
58c38d0a54fb82070bd0c5ccbfc30b68dd0aef4b1bfe2b222a30b6c813f5f7e2
spent
true